Glass in my dinner. I go to Fuji's often, and am usually satisfied with the atmosphere, and the staff. I went last night and as I was eating a maki roll, bit on something hard. It was a piece of glass! My boyfriend brought it to the attention of our waitress who said "oh no, I shouldnt say this but it happens. We're busy" She offered to get us a new order, or take that item off of our bill. OBVIOUSLY I couldnt eat anything else, not only was my mouth cut, but I didnt know the source of the broken glass, and was not going to risk it happening again. We were unable to talk to a manager, but were obviously dissatisfied with their sollution. I just am so confused as to how she could have told us "it happens" and not comp my meal as I couldnt eat anything else!!!

Our Families Favorite Restaurant. This is one of the best restaurants in town. Upstairs is traditional Japanese fare including delicious sushi. (Don't miss the Casco Bay Roll!) Downstairs are grill tables for delicious food prepared right in front of you. We have been loving to eat at Fuji for about 20 years and it's always been just great.

If you're ever in Portland, Maine, you must have a meal at Fuji. If you live in Portland and have never been to Fuji, shame on you! I'm not just talking about the fabulous food. The presentation you get at the hibachi table is spectacular. The chefs can throw fire and create a volcano out of an onion. The chef who prepared the meal at my table had a great sense of humor, obviously enjoyed his work, told us that he has 6 styles of cuisine under his belt...and is only 20 years old.
Make a reservation. The hibachi room fills up fast. Just don't miss out on this experience.
